关注分享主机优惠活动
国内外VPS云服务器

python任意二进制转换的方法是什么(如何使用python进行二进制转换)?

Python可以使用内置函数bin()、oct()和hex()在任意二进制系统之间进行转换。具体方法如下:

十进制到二进制:bin(数字),将十进制数字转换为二进制数字。

十进制数= 10
binary _ num = bin(decimal _ num)
print(binary _ num)#输出:0b1010

十进制到八进制:oct(数字),将十进制数字转换为八进制数字。

十进制数= 10
八进制数=十进制数
print(octal _ num)#输出:0o12

十进制到十六进制:十六进制(数字),将十进制数字转换为十六进制数字。

十进制数= 10
十六进制数字=十六进制(十进制数字)
Print(十六进制数字)#输出:0xa

其他十进制转换:使用int()函数并指定原始数字的基数。

binary _ num =》0。1010英寸
十进制数=整数(二进制数,2)
print(decimal _ num)#输出:10

octal _ num =》0。12个。
decimal _ num = int(octal _ num,8)
print(decimal _ num)#输出:10

十六进制数=》1。一个:
decimal_num = int(十六进制数,16)
print(decimal _ num)#输出:10

以上内容来自互联网,不代表本站全部观点!欢迎关注我们:zhujipindao。com

未经允许不得转载:主机频道 » python任意二进制转换的方法是什么(如何使用python进行二进制转换)?

评论 抢沙发

评论前必须登录!